Comprehending the Basics of Spray Foam Insulation



Although often forgotten, spray foam insulation plays a pivotal role in modern-day structure construction and improvement. It is a type of building product utilized to provide thermal insulation, reduce undesirable air infiltration, and develop a wetness obstacle. There are two kinds: open-cell and closed-cell spray foam. The previous is much less dense and more affordable, making it an optimal choice for interior applications. The last, denser and much more expensive, is used in exterior and roof applications because of its higher R-value and moisture resistance homes. The application procedure includes spraying a liquid product that quickly broadens and hardens right into foam, filling up voids and developing an airtight seal. Therefore, spray foam insulation confirms vital for energy performance and architectural integrity.

Insulation Density and R-Value



In evaluating the efficiency of any kind of insulation, 2 crucial elements enter into play: insulation thickness and R-value. The R-value measures the resistance of warmth circulation with the insulation, with higher values suggesting remarkable efficiency. Spray foam insulation typically has a higher R-value per inch than other protecting products. This indicates that much less thickness is required to accomplish the exact same thermal efficiency. It not only saves room but also decreases building and construction expenses. In addition, spray foam insulation broadens as soon as installed, filling gaps and creating a more efficient obstacle against warmth loss. This one-of-a-kind high quality more raises its R-value, making it an excellent option for modern-day structures seeking power effectiveness and remarkable thermal performance.

Making The Most Of Thermal Efficiency





To attain maximum thermal effectiveness in modern-day structures, spray foam insulation is a stellar choice. This insulation kind is known for its premium capability to obstruct heat transfer, which is type in preserving a constant indoor temperature level year-round. Unlike standard insulation materials, spray foam expands upon installment, filling up voids and producing a limited seal. This prevents thermal connecting, a typical issue where warm escapes with uninsulated sections of the structure envelope. By decreasing warmth loss and gain, spray foam insulation maximizes the structure's thermal performance, lowering the strain on home heating and cooling down systems. Subsequently, this results in significant energy conservation, adding to a much more lasting constructed environment. Therefore, spray foam insulation is an essential tool in optimizing thermal performance in contemporary building.
